Jaclyn Rautbort Tropp recounts her experience as a hemodialysis nurse in Saigon, Vietnam in the 629th Medical Detachment at the 3rd Field Hospital. As a young Lieutenant, she is placed as the Officer in Charge of the Hemodialysis Unit. An area of medicine she had little to no experience beforehand. Joining the Army greatly helped her achieve her dreams of being a nurse and there is no doubt that the training she received aided her in her career after returning from the war. Jackie also recalls the advice she received from her mother, a former WW2 Army nurse, before joining the Army. This wisdom aided her through many potentially negative situations.

This week we hear from Cecily Roland, a 22 year retiree from the Air Force Reserves and Air national Guard. She discusses her career as a surgical tech and medic while relocating bases through BRAC (Base Realignment and Closing). Although she is retired from the Air Force Guard as well as her civilian career, she continues to spend time in many veteran activities. She describes several different organizations in the Chicagoland area which offer free activities for veterans. These activities and opportunities help her stay active and allow her to meet new people and make friends.
